Delays can be costly in hotel accident claims. Nevada's personal injury filing deadline generally allows two years from the moment harm occurred to pursue compensation. Past timing concerns, surveillance footage is often overwritten as months go by. How do I prove a hotel was negligent after my accident?

Establishing fault involves demonstrating that management was aware of the hazard that caused your injury and did nothing to correct it. Key forms of evidence include surveillance footage showing the hazard, expert testimony from safety consultants. Our legal team takes responsibility for building the record on your behalf.

What if I contributed to the accident at the hotel?

Nevada follows a proportional fault system, meaning you can still recover compensation as long as the hotel was also at fault. The damages you receive will be adjusted downward based on how much responsibility you carry. A hotel accident lawyer will build evidence that focuses blame on the hotel.
